Ultrasound Therapy Machine 1 MHz for Pain Management & Rehabilitation

Ultrasound treatment utilizing a frequency of 1 MHz has emerged as a popular modality in pain management and rehabilitation. This therapeutic technique leverages sound waves to generate heat within tissues, promoting recovery. The application of low-intensity ultrasound stimulates blood flow, reduces inflammation, and alleviates pain signals transmitted to the brain.

The benefits of 1 MHz ultrasound extend beyond pain management, as it can also improve muscle contractility, here increase range of motion, and reduce stiffness. This versatile modality is often integrated into treatment plans for a wide array of conditions, including musculoskeletal injuries, degenerative disorders, and postoperative recovery.
